    History of Thomas Crane Library in Quincy

    Founded in 1889, the Thomas Crane Library in Quincy was named after its benefactor, Thomas Crane, a successful businessman and philanthropist. His vision was to create a space where the community could access knowledge and resources freely. Over the years, the library has grown from a small collection of books to a modern facility equipped with advanced technology and a wide array of services.

    Early Beginnings

    The library began as a modest project, but Crane's generous donations and the support of the local government allowed it to flourish. Initially housed in a small building, the library soon expanded to accommodate the growing demand for educational resources.

    Significant Developments

    Throughout its history, the Thomas Crane Library in Quincy has undergone several renovations and expansions. The most notable development came in the early 20th century when the library adopted new systems for cataloging and lending books, making it more accessible to the public.

    Facilities and Resources

    The Thomas Crane Library in Quincy offers a wide range of facilities and resources designed to meet the diverse needs of its patrons.

    Book Collection

    With over 150,000 books in its collection, the library caters to readers of all ages and interests. From classic literature to contemporary bestsellers, the library ensures there is something for everyone. Additionally, the library provides specialized collections for children, teens, and adults.

    Media Resources

    Besides books, the library offers a variety of media resources, including DVDs, CDs, and e-books. These resources are curated to provide entertainment and educational content, making the library a one-stop destination for multimedia enthusiasts.

  • Programs and Events

    The Thomas Crane Library in Quincy is not just a repository of books; it is also a vibrant center for programs and events that cater to the community's needs.

    • Storytime for Kids: A weekly program that encourages young children to develop a love for reading.
    • Book Clubs: Monthly meetings where book lovers gather to discuss their favorite reads.
    • Workshops: Regular sessions on topics such as digital literacy, creative writing, and financial planning.

    Digital Library Services

    In response to the increasing demand for digital resources, the Thomas Crane Library in Quincy has expanded its digital offerings. Patrons can access e-books, audiobooks, and online databases through the library's website, providing convenience and flexibility.

    Online Databases

    The library subscribes to several reputable online databases, offering access to academic journals, newspapers, and research articles. These resources are invaluable for students and researchers looking to deepen their understanding of various subjects.

    Community Engagement

    The Thomas Crane Library in Quincy plays a vital role in fostering community engagement. It serves as a meeting place for local groups, hosts cultural events, and collaborates with schools and other organizations to promote education and awareness.

    Partnerships

    The library has established partnerships with local schools, universities, and cultural institutions to enhance its offerings and reach a broader audience. These collaborations ensure that the library remains a relevant and dynamic institution in the community.

    Architectural Significance

    The Thomas Crane Library in Quincy is not only significant for its resources but also for its architectural beauty. The building itself is a work of art, showcasing elements of classical design that reflect the era in which it was built.

    Design Features

    The library's design incorporates grand arches, intricate stonework, and spacious interiors that create an inviting atmosphere for visitors. Its architecture is a testament to the vision of its founders and the dedication of those who have preserved it over the years.

    Biography of Thomas Crane

    Thomas Crane, the man behind the library's establishment, was a prominent figure in Quincy's history. Born in 1835, he made his fortune in the leather industry before turning his attention to philanthropy. His commitment to education and community development led to the creation of the Thomas Crane Library in Quincy.

    Contributions to the Community

    Crane's contributions extended beyond the library. He was actively involved in various civic projects and charitable activities, leaving a lasting legacy in Quincy.
